Our Locations
Ecobat Resources Austria
Ecobat Resources Austria has been in the business of lead and tin smelting for over 500 years. The smelter produces around 27,000 tonnes of lead and lead alloys, and 3,800 tonnes of sodium sulphate and 1,400 tonnes of polypropylene.